Job Description Summary
Under the direction of the Director of the MUSC Conflict of Interest Office, this position is responsible for providing institutional compliance support related to Conflict of Interest (COI) regulatory requirements and institutional policies. This position will assist the COI Program to ensure adherence to institutional policies/procedures and regulatory requirements related to the disclosure, identification, evaluation, documentation, management, and tracking of actual/potential conflicts of interest in order to maintain compliance and institutional integrity. Job Description
25% - Responsible for oversight of intake process of faculty, staff, and researchers’ financial/outside activity related disclosures for quality control and required corrective actions. Conduct initial evaluation of outside activities/financial interests in relation to institutional responsibilities and make an initial determination (based on relevant regulations/policy) as to whether potential conflicts of interest exist. Essential
25% - Organize and manage the COI Program’s intake/documentation related processes including, but not limited to: disclosures, COI management plans, MUSC enterprise COI related inquiries/evaluations/investigations, Enterprise/Research COI committees, website, etc.; Evaluate current COI program administrative processes/procedures and research/identify potential opportunities to improve efficiency/effectiveness. Essential
25% - Assist with the development of COI Office/Committee correspondence to faculty, staff, research personnel and
deans/department chairs regarding conflict of interest determinations, management plans, COI committee concerns or requests for supplemental information. This position will regularly correspond with individual faculty and staff members as well as academic and administrative units. Essential
20% - Assist with the prioritization and processing of COI reviews and disclosure related data analyses/reporting. In coordination with other Conflicts of Interest Program staff and MUSC compliance/legal staff, this position will assist with the development/administration of other campus-wide compliance initiatives that support the MUSC Enterprise’s extensive research program, innovation and commercialization programs/efforts, and other program initiatives. Essential
5% - Perform other MUSC Conflict of Interest Office duties as assigned. Essential
